对python opencv 添加文字 cv2.putText 的各参数介绍


Posted in Python onDecember 05, 2018

如下所示:

cv2.putText(img, str(i), (123,456)), font, 2, (0,255,0), 3)

各参数依次是:图片,添加的文字,左上角坐标,字体,字体大小,颜色,字体粗细

其中字体可以选择

FONT_HERSHEY_SIMPLEX
Python: cv.FONT_HERSHEY_SIMPLEX
normal size sans-serif font

FONT_HERSHEY_PLAIN
Python: cv.FONT_HERSHEY_PLAIN
small size sans-serif font

FONT_HERSHEY_DUPLEX
Python: cv.FONT_HERSHEY_DUPLEX
normal size sans-serif font (more complex than FONT_HERSHEY_SIMPLEX)

FONT_HERSHEY_COMPLEX
Python: cv.FONT_HERSHEY_COMPLEX
normal size serif font

FONT_HERSHEY_TRIPLEX
Python: cv.FONT_HERSHEY_TRIPLEX
normal size serif font (more complex than FONT_HERSHEY_COMPLEX)

FONT_HERSHEY_COMPLEX_SMALL
Python: cv.FONT_HERSHEY_COMPLEX_SMALL
smaller version of FONT_HERSHEY_COMPLEX

FONT_HERSHEY_SCRIPT_SIMPLEX
Python: cv.FONT_HERSHEY_SCRIPT_SIMPLEX
hand-writing style font

FONT_HERSHEY_SCRIPT_COMPLEX
Python: cv.FONT_HERSHEY_SCRIPT_COMPLEX
more complex variant of FONT_HERSHEY_SCRIPT_SIMPLEX

FONT_ITALIC
Python: cv.FONT_ITALIC
flag for italic font

字体大小,数值越大,字体越大

字体粗细,越大越粗,数值表示线占有直径像素个数

void cv::putText(
 InputOutputArray img,
 const String & text,
 Point org,
 int  fontFace,
 double fontScale,
 Scalar color,
 int  thickness = 1,
 int  lineType = LINE_8,
 bool bottomLeftOrigin = false 
)  
Python:
img =cv.putText(img, text, org, fontFace,fontScale, color[, thickness[, lineType[, bottomLeftOrigin]]])

以上这篇对python opencv 添加文字 cv2.putText 的各参数介绍就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python错误处理详解
Sep 28 Python
详解Python中for循环的使用
Apr 14 Python
基于python的字节编译详解
Sep 20 Python
你真的了解Python的random模块吗?
Dec 12 Python
pycharm修改界面主题颜色的方法
Jan 17 Python
Python切片操作去除字符串首尾的空格
Apr 22 Python
Python程序包的构建和发布过程示例详解
Jun 09 Python
Python3 Tkinkter + SQLite实现登录和注册界面
Nov 19 Python
python实现猜单词游戏
May 22 Python
Flask中sqlalchemy模块的实例用法
Aug 02 Python
python exit出错原因整理
Aug 31 Python
详解在OpenCV中如何使用图像像素
Mar 03 Python
Python寻找两个有序数组的中位数实例详解
Dec 05 #Python
解决Python下imread,imwrite不支持中文的问题
Dec 05 #Python
python批量下载网站马拉松照片的完整步骤
Dec 05 #Python
解决python3中cv2读取中文路径的问题
Dec 05 #Python
利用Python求阴影部分的面积实例代码
Dec 05 #Python
python之cv2与图像的载入、显示和保存实例
Dec 05 #Python
python存储16bit和32bit图像的实例
Dec 05 #Python
You might like
php中批量删除Mysql中相同前缀的数据表的代码
2011/07/01 PHP
PHP中数组合并的两种方法及区别介绍
2012/09/14 PHP
PHP遍历目录函数opendir()、readdir()、closedir()、rewinddir()总结
2014/11/18 PHP
PHP获取当前相对于域名目录的方法
2015/06/26 PHP
yii2利用自带UploadedFile实现上传图片的示例
2017/02/16 PHP
PHP扩展mcrypt实现的AES加密功能示例
2019/01/29 PHP
Laravel框架Eloquent ORM简介、模型建立及查询数据操作详解
2019/12/04 PHP
jQuery 计算iframe 窗口大小的方法
2014/05/13 Javascript
理运用命名空间让js不产生冲突避免全局变量的泛滥
2014/06/15 Javascript
AngularJS内置指令
2015/02/04 Javascript
浅谈jquery中的each方法$.each、this.each、$.fn.each
2016/06/23 Javascript
JS如何设置iOS中微信浏览器的title
2016/11/22 Javascript
BootStrap表单验证实例代码
2017/01/13 Javascript
Vue对象赋值视图不更新问题及解决方法
2019/06/03 Javascript
Vue.js 中的实用工具方法【推荐】
2019/07/04 Javascript
layui关闭层级、简单监听的实例
2019/09/06 Javascript
vue循环数组改变点击文字的颜色
2019/10/14 Javascript
vue 项目@change多个参数传值多个事件的操作
2021/01/29 Vue.js
Python面向对象编程中的类和对象学习教程
2015/03/30 Python
在Python中使用PIL模块对图片进行高斯模糊处理的教程
2015/05/05 Python
Python 提取dict转换为xml/json/table并输出的实现代码
2016/08/28 Python
python实现自动获取IP并发送到邮箱
2018/12/26 Python
python线程信号量semaphore使用解析
2019/11/30 Python
详解CSS3 弹性布局快速入门
2019/06/06 HTML / CSS
全球性的在线时尚男装零售商:boohooMAN
2016/12/17 全球购物
美国创意之家:BulbHead
2017/07/12 全球购物
HealthElement海外旗舰店:新西兰大卖场
2018/02/23 全球购物
国际旅客访问北美最大的汽车租赁提供商:Alamo Rent A Car
2018/06/13 全球购物
英国在线电子和小工具商店:TecoBuy
2018/10/06 全球购物
安全生产月演讲稿
2014/05/09 职场文书
工伤事故赔偿协议书(标准)
2014/09/29 职场文书
关于群众路线的心得体会
2014/11/05 职场文书
服务整改报告
2014/11/06 职场文书
销售2014年度工作总结
2014/12/08 职场文书
电影建党伟业观后感
2015/06/01 职场文书
德劲DE1107指针试高灵敏度全波段收音机机评
2022/04/05 无线电